Slim + Husky’s Pizza Beeria has become the first Black-owned restaurant on Nashville’s most popular street after opening on Fifth and Broadway.

Co-founded by Nashville natives Clint Gray, Derrick Moore, and Emanuel Reed in 2017, Slim + Husky’s is a fast-casual and gourmet pizza joint serving up artisan pizzas and unique cinnamon rolls.

On the menu are pizzas inspired by hip-hop songs and artists. There’s “got 5 on it,” which comes with classic red sauce, a cheese blend, and fresh mozzarella, the “red light special,” with spicy red sauce, fresh mozzarella, heirloom tomato blend, and fresh mozzarella; the “nothing but a ‘v’ thang,” giving vegans an option with plant-based cheese and pepperoni, and more.

There are with locations in Nashville, Atlanta, Sacramento, and Memphis. The owners aim to invigorate less touched areas of the community through employment opportunities and accessible dining experiences including locally brewed craft beer and innovative pizza creations.

In addition to enjoying Slim + Husky’s award-winning pizza, customers can listen to live performances by local musicians and peruse artwork showcased by Tennessee artists DoughJoe, Bexclusives, Trigger, Gallery Symf, X Payne, LeXander Bryant, YOuNique, Walter Louis Smith II, and Santiago Ortiz-Piazuelo, as reported in Eater.
